当前位置:首页  /  软件评测  /  上古卷轴5,代码背后的魔法世界

上古卷轴5,代码背后的魔法世界

分类:软件评测

上古卷轴5:天际,作为一款备受玩家喜爱的角色扮演游戏,自2006年上市以来,凭借其丰富的世界观、引人入胜的故事情节和独特的游戏体验,赢得了无数玩家的喜爱。而在这背后,是一群才华横溢的程序员们用代码构建出的一个魔法世界。本文将带您揭开上古卷轴5的代码之谜,探寻这个游戏世界的奥秘。

一、上古卷轴5的世界观

上古卷轴5:天际的故事发生在一个名为“天际”的大陆。在这个世界里,人类、精灵、兽人、矮人等种族共存,魔法与科技并存,形成了独特的文化氛围。游戏中的世界观是由程序员们用代码精心构建的,其中包括地形、气候、种族、文化等众多元素。

二、上古卷轴5的代码架构

上古卷轴5的代码架构分为以下几个层次:

1. 游戏引擎:游戏引擎是游戏开发的基础,负责处理游戏中的图形、音效、物理等核心功能。上古卷轴5使用的游戏引擎为“Gamebryo”,它为游戏提供了强大的图形渲染和物理模拟能力。

2. 世界生成:游戏中的世界是通过代码生成的,包括地形、气候、资源等。程序员们利用算法和数据结构,模拟出真实的世界环境,让玩家在游戏中体验到身临其境的感觉。

3. 角色与怪物:游戏中的角色和怪物都是由代码创建的。程序员们为每个角色和怪物设定了属性、技能、装备等,使得游戏中的角色各具特色,怪物充满挑战性。

4. 故事情节:上古卷轴5的故事情节是通过代码实现的。程序员们编写了大量的脚本,控制着角色的行为、对话和事件的发生,为玩家呈现了一个丰富多彩的故事世界。

三、上古卷轴5的代码艺术

1. 算法之美:上古卷轴5的代码中,有许多精妙的算法。例如,游戏中的迷宫生成算法,能够为玩家随机生成各种迷宫,增加了游戏的趣味性。

2. 数据结构:上古卷轴5的代码中,运用了多种数据结构,如链表、树、图等,使得游戏中的数据组织更加高效,提高了游戏的性能。

3. 代码注释:上古卷轴5的代码注释详细,便于其他程序员理解和维护。这体现了程序员们严谨的工作态度和对团队协作的重视。

四、上古卷轴5的代码魅力

上古卷轴5的代码魅力体现在以下几个方面:

1. 灵活多变:上古卷轴5的代码结构灵活,便于修改和扩展。这使得游戏在后续版本中能够不断优化和升级。

2. 创新性:上古卷轴5的代码在许多方面都体现了创新,如独特的魔法系统、丰富的种族设定等。

3. 团队协作:上古卷轴5的代码由多个程序员共同完成,展现了团队合作的力量。

上古卷轴5的代码构建出了一个充满魔法与冒险的世界。这个游戏世界的背后,是一群才华横溢的程序员们用代码编织出的梦想。正是这些代码,让玩家们能够在天际大陆上尽情探索、冒险。

猜你喜欢

全部评论(0
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
验证码